Latest Patents

Among Naylor's latest patents is the "Reverse-phase polymerization process." This innovative process involves a reverse-phase suspension polymerization method for producing polymer beads through the formation of aqueous monomer beads. The process allows for the polymerization of monomers while suspended in a non-aqueous liquid, optimizing the manufacturing of polymer beads. Notably, his patent emphasizes the vibrational management of the aqueous monomer or orifices, ensuring optimal polymer synthesis.

Another significant invention is the "Production of polymers in a conical reactor." This process outlines a method where an aqueous mixture of monoethylenically unsaturated monomers is polymerized in a specialized conical reactor setup. This unique design facilitates the efficient production of polymers while minimizing waste and enhancing output quality.

Career Highlights

Naylor has amassed extensive experience through his work at notable companies such as Ciba Specialty Chemicals Water Treatments Limited and Ciba Specialty Chemicals Corporation.
